GSC_PAGE_QUERIES
Obtén las consultas de búsqueda que generan tráfico a una página específica.
=GSC_PAGE_QUERIES(pageUrl, startDate, endDate, [limit], [siteUrl])Devuelve: 2D array with columns: Query, Clicks, Impressions, CTR, Position
Descripción General
GSC_PAGE_QUERIES revela exactamente qué consultas de búsqueda están generando tráfico a cualquier página específica de tu sitio web. Al proporcionar una URL de página, rango de fechas y parámetros opcionales, obtienes un desglose detallado de cada palabra clave que provocó que tu página apareciera en los resultados de búsqueda de Google, junto con los clics, impresiones, CTR y posición promedio para cada consulta. Esta es una de las funciones más accionables para optimización de contenido porque te muestra la intención de búsqueda real detrás de cada página.
Parámetros
| Parámetro | Tipo | Requerido | Descripción |
|---|---|---|---|
pageUrl | string | Sí | La URL completa de la página a analizar (ej., "https://example.com/blog/my-post"). |
startDate | string | Sí | Fecha de inicio en formato "YYYY-MM-DD" o formato relativo como "-30d" para hace 30 días. |
endDate | string | Sí | Fecha de fin en formato "YYYY-MM-DD" o formato relativo como "-1d" para ayer. |
limit | number | No (100) | Número máximo de consultas a devolver. Por defecto 100, máximo 25000. |
siteUrl | string | No | La propiedad URL del sitio desde Search Console. Si se omite, usa la propiedad conectada por defecto. |
Ejemplos
Consultas para una publicación de blog
Ve qué consultas de búsqueda están enviando tráfico a una publicación de blog específica en los últimos 30 días.
=GSC_PAGE_QUERIES("https://example.com/blog/seo-guide", "-30d", "-1d")Salida
| Query | Clicks | Impressions | CTR | Position |
| seo guide 2025 | 340 | 5200 | 6.5% | 2.8 |
| seo best practices | 210 | 8900 | 2.4% | 7.3 |
| how to do seo | 180 | 6100 | 3.0% | 5.6 |
| search engine optimization guide | 95 | 3400 | 2.8% | 6.1 |
Consultas para una página de producto
Obtén las 50 principales consultas que generan tráfico a una página de producto en la última semana.
=GSC_PAGE_QUERIES("https://store.com/products/wireless-headphones", "-7d", "-1d", 50)Salida
| Query | Clicks | Impressions | CTR | Position |
| wireless headphones | 120 | 3800 | 3.2% | 6.4 |
| best wireless headphones 2025 | 85 | 2100 | 4.0% | 4.2 |
| bluetooth headphones review | 62 | 1900 | 3.3% | 5.8 |
Análisis de consultas de página principal
Analiza las 500 principales consultas que llevan usuarios a la página principal en los últimos 3 meses para entender el tráfico de marca vs. no-marca.
=GSC_PAGE_QUERIES("https://myapp.com/", "-90d", "-1d", 500)Salida
| Query | Clicks | Impressions | CTR | Position |
| myapp | 8200 | 12000 | 68.3% | 1.0 |
| myapp.com | 3100 | 4500 | 68.9% | 1.0 |
| task management app | 450 | 18000 | 2.5% | 8.2 |
| best productivity tool | 280 | 15000 | 1.9% | 9.5 |
URL de página dinámica desde referencia de celda
Usa una referencia de celda para la URL de página para que puedas cambiar rápidamente entre páginas sin editar la fórmula. Coloca la URL en la celda A2.
=GSC_PAGE_QUERIES(A2, "-30d", "-1d", 200)Salida
| Query | Clicks | Impressions | CTR | Position |
| crm comparison | 520 | 9400 | 5.5% | 3.1 |
| best crm for small business | 380 | 7200 | 5.3% | 4.5 |
| crm software reviews | 290 | 6800 | 4.3% | 5.2 |
Consultas para una propiedad de prefijo URL
Especifica una propiedad de prefijo URL explícitamente cuando tu cuenta tiene múltiples propiedades.
=GSC_PAGE_QUERIES("https://blog.company.com/post/analytics", "-30d", "-1d", 100, "https://blog.company.com/")Salida
| Query | Clicks | Impressions | CTR | Position |
| web analytics tutorial | 190 | 4200 | 4.5% | 3.8 |
| google analytics setup | 145 | 5100 | 2.8% | 6.2 |
| analytics for beginners | 110 | 3300 | 3.3% | 5.1 |
Casos de Uso
Priorización de Actualización de Contenido
Los equipos de contenido analizan datos de consultas a nivel de página para determinar qué artículos deben actualizarse primero, enfocándose en páginas donde la palabra clave principal ha caído en posición o donde han surgido nuevas consultas relevantes.
Detección de Canibalización de Palabras Clave
Los especialistas SEO ejecutan GSC_PAGE_QUERIES en múltiples páginas dirigidas a temas similares para identificar canibalización de palabras clave, donde dos o más páginas compiten por las mismas consultas y diluyen el potencial de ranking mutuo.
Auditoría SEO de Páginas de Producto
Los equipos SEO de e-commerce auditan páginas de producto para verificar que las palabras clave objetivo previstas son las que realmente generan tráfico, y descubrir nuevas consultas long-tail de producto para agregar a títulos y descripciones.
Ajuste de Intención de Páginas de Destino
Los equipos de marketing de producto analizan datos de consulta para páginas de destino clave para asegurar que el mensaje de la página se alinee con la intención de búsqueda de los visitantes, mejorando tanto rankings SEO como tasas de conversión.
Optimización de Enlaces Internos
Los editores usan datos de consultas de página para construir estrategias de enlaces internos más inteligentes, conectando páginas que comparten consultas relacionadas y creando clusters de temas que fortalecen la autoridad general del dominio.
Consejos Profesionales
Construye una plantilla de auditoría de contenido: lista tus principales páginas en la columna A, luego usa =GSC_PAGE_QUERIES(A2, "-30d", "-1d", 10) en celdas adyacentes para ver las palabras clave principales de cada página de un vistazo.
Busca consultas con altas impresiones pero posiciones 8-20: estas son palabras clave al borde de la página 1 donde pequeñas mejoras de contenido podrían generar ganancias significativas de tráfico.
Compara la consulta principal de cada página contra el H1 y título de la página. Si no coinciden, actualizar el título para incluir la consulta principal a menudo mejora el CTR y los rankings.
Usa formato condicional para resaltar consultas con CTR por debajo del 2% en los resultados, facilitando detectar oportunidades de mejoras en meta descripciones.
Para planificación de clusters de contenido, ejecuta GSC_PAGE_QUERIES en tu página pilar y busca consultas que merezcan sus propias páginas dedicadas, luego crea esas páginas y enlaza de vuelta al pilar.
La optimización de contenido comienza con entender qué están buscando realmente los usuarios cuando llegan a tu página. GSC_PAGE_QUERIES cierra la brecha entre tu contenido y la intención del usuario mostrándote las frases exactas que Google asocia con tu página. Podrías descubrir que una publicación de blog sobre "consejos de email marketing" también está rankeando para "cómo escribir líneas de asunto" o "tasas de apertura de email" -- consultas que podrías dirigir mejor con actualizaciones de contenido o nuevas páginas dedicadas.
Esta función es particularmente poderosa para auditorías SEO on-page. Para cada página importante, extrae sus datos de consulta para verificar que tu palabra clave objetivo sea efectivamente la consulta principal por clics. Si consultas inesperadas dominan, señala un desajuste de contenido-intención que necesita atención. También puedes identificar problemas de canibalización verificando si múltiples páginas compiten por las mismas consultas. Usa el parámetro de límite para ver más allá de las palabras clave principales obvias y explorar las consultas long-tail que colectivamente pueden representar una porción significativa de tu tráfico. Combinada con GSC_TOP_PAGES, esta función permite un flujo de trabajo de auditoría de contenido página por página completamente dentro de Google Sheets.
Errores Comunes
NO_DATA: No search data found for the specified pageCausa: La URL de página no coincide con ninguna página indexada en Search Console, o la página no tuvo impresiones durante el rango de fechas especificado.
Solución: Verifica la URL de página exacta revisando la salida de GSC_TOP_PAGES o la interfaz de Search Console. Asegúrate de que la URL incluya el protocolo (https://), ruta correcta y cualquier barra final. Intenta ampliar el rango de fechas para capturar más datos.
NOT_AUTHORIZED: Access to Search Console property deniedCausa: Tu cuenta de Google conectada no tiene acceso a la propiedad de Search Console que posee la URL de página especificada.
Solución: Verifica que la URL de página pertenezca a una propiedad de Search Console a la que tengas acceso. Si la página está bajo una propiedad diferente (ej., una propiedad de subdominio), especifica el parámetro siteUrl correcto.
INVALID_URL: Page URL must be a valid URLCausa: El parámetro pageUrl no es una URL formateada correctamente.
Solución: Asegúrate de que la URL comience con "https://" o "http://", incluya el dominio y tenga la ruta correcta. No incluyas fragmentos de URL (#section). Si refieres una celda, asegúrate de que la celda contenga una cadena de URL válida.
Preguntas Frecuentes
Sí, el pageUrl debe coincidir exactamente como aparece en Search Console, incluyendo el protocolo (https://), barras finales y cualquier parámetro de consulta. Si no estás seguro de la URL exacta, primero usa GSC_TOP_PAGES para ver cómo Google reporta tus URLs de página, luego copia la cadena exacta.
No, GSC_PAGE_QUERIES requiere una URL de página exacta. Para filtrar por patrones de URL (como todas las páginas bajo /blog/), usa GSC_QUERY con un filtro de página usando el operador "contains" en su lugar.
Esto puede suceder debido al límite de filas. Si una página rankea para miles de consultas y solo recuperas 100, la suma será menor que el total. Aumenta el parámetro de límite para capturar más consultas. Además, las consultas anonimizadas (búsquedas muy raras) no se reportan individualmente pero se incluyen en los totales agregados de página.
Usa una función FILTER sobre los resultados: =FILTER(GSC_PAGE_QUERIES(url, start, end, 1000), INDEX(GSC_PAGE_QUERIES(url, start, end, 1000),,5) > 10). Esto filtra por consultas donde la posición promedio es mayor a 10, lo que significa que tu página típicamente aparece en la página 2 o más allá.
Sí, ejecutando GSC_PAGE_QUERIES para diferentes rangos de fechas y comparando resultados. Para una vista de serie temporal, usa GSC_QUERY con dimensiones "query" y "date" y un filtro de página para ver el rendimiento diario de consultas para una página específica.
Si la URL especificada no tiene datos de búsqueda (o no existe, no está indexada o no tuvo impresiones durante el rango de fechas), la función devuelve un resultado vacío con solo la fila de encabezado. Verifica dos veces el formato de URL e intenta un rango de fechas más amplio.
Search Console típicamente consolida datos AMP y móviles bajo la URL canónica. Usa la URL canónica como el parámetro pageUrl. Si tu sitio usa URLs móviles separadas (m.example.com), esas serían páginas separadas en Search Console y necesitarías consultarlas individualmente.
Funciones Relacionadas
GSC_TOP_PAGES
Obtén las principales páginas desde Google Search Console ordenadas por clics.
GSC_TOP_QUERIES
Obtén las principales consultas de búsqueda desde Google Search Console ordenadas por clics.
GSC_KEYWORD_POSITION
Obtén la posición promedio para una palabra clave específica desde Google Search Console.
Comienza a usar GSC_PAGE_QUERIES hoy
Instala Unlimited Sheets para obtener GSC_PAGE_QUERIES y 41 otras funciones poderosas en Google Sheets.